Sat 1296966974048217

decimal
308786.1974048217
degree
0°98786′338″1974048217‴
percentile
61.76033216547053%
name
eqwknwzzfgy
cycle
0
epoch
1
period
153
block
308786
offset
1974048217
timestamp
rarity
common